    5.2 GSM&GPS signal searching After the power is on, it will start searching the GSM and GPS signal. During this period, the green indicator (GSM indicator) will be flashing while the blue indicator will be flashing quickly. When the blue indicator is flashing slowly, it means GPS has located. 5.3 Power OFF Pull out the SIM card, the terminal will be off.

  • Page 13 Send SMS command: PARAM# The terminal will reply messages including: IMEI number, GPRS upload interval, time interval that GPS is activated when ACC is off, SOS numbers, center number, sensor alarm interval, defense time and time zone. 6.6 Set GPS data upload interval (1) Upload by interval The default upload interval is 20 seconds, which means every 20 seconds the terminal will upload its location data to the platform.
  • Page 14 6.7 Corners upload (ON as default) The terminal will upload GPS data to the platform when the vehicle is turning (the turning angle reaches the pre-set value). NOTE: if the speed is too low during turning, the GPS data will be not able to upload to the platform.

  • Page 16 The platform website: www.jimishare.com Please contact your supplier for the login methods and operations. 7.2 Vibration Alarm (ON as default) When the vehicle is turned off (ACC low) and stays off for 3 minutes (pre-set), the terminal will enter arm status. During this time, if the terminal detects 6 times vibrations (default) and the vehicle still stays off (ACC off) in 30 seconds, it will activate vibration alarm.
